Easy Guide For Beginners To Make a Professional Website

Complete Guide to Get you Started Quickly

Perfect for Beginners and DIY Enthusiasts

Updated: December 19, 2025
By: RSH Web Editorial Staff

Contact Us

Menu

Website Creation Guild

If you are considering designing a new website or want to redo your current, outdated website, you will be faced with some important decisions. We are going to help you with these decisions by showing your choices and explaining how specific options may fit your needs. We will explain and help you understand what type of websites you can build, and if needed choosing a Domain Name. To the finishing touches that will help you launch your website successfully, what ever your goals might be.

Lets start by defining your site’s purpose and target audience. Choose a domain name that reflects your brand and select a reliable web hosting provider. Design your site using a website builder, CMS or even by hand, ensuring a user-friendly interface and appealing visuals. Create high-quality content optimized for search engines, and make sure your site is mobile-friendly. Test your website thoroughly for functionality, performance, and compatibility across different devices and browsers. Once ready, publish your site and promote it through social media and other channels to attract visitors. Finally, monitor site performance, update content regularly, and maintain security to keep your website running smoothly. These tips will help you establish a strong online presence and ensure a successful website launch.

Selecting the Right Tools

With so many options available today, it can be difficult to choose the best program or Website Builder for the job. Choosing a platform such as a (CMS) Content Management System's or a Website Builder upon which you build your website can be one of the most important decisions you make. This choice can be critical because you will be tied to that platform for some time, and it’s never easy to move your website from one platform to another. The best and most popular tool for making a website is the WordPress Content Management System (CMS). It is recommended by many designers. You can make any website with WordPress, be it a one-page business card website, a site with a blog, and even an e-commerce website.

Domain Names

Once you’ve selected the right platform for your website, you need to start thinking of a domain name. This domain will be your-name.com, your-business.com or almost anything. Even though the .COM domain extension is the most popular, There are more than 1,500 Domain Name Extensions (TLDs), And it seems to be increasing every day. Although they are not as popular as the original TLDs, you may also encounter some of these newer domain extensions when browsing the web.
The 7 Most Common Domain Extensions:
.com (commercial)
.org (organization)
.net (network)
.us (United States)
.biz (Business)
.info (Information)
.pro (Professional)

Other Top-Level Domain Names
.top .accountant .bid .company .cricket .date .download .faith .loan .men .party .racing .review .science .stream .trade .webcam .win .works
The following 4 are part of the original Internet specifications for domain extensions and may not be available to the Public:
.int (international) .mil (military) .edu (education) .gov (government).

For a complete listing of all Internet Top Level Domain extensions, jump on over to IANA.

For most people, the first goal when choosing a Domain Name is to get the .com top-level domain whenever possible.

Take a look at our blog on choosing a domain name and some tips to selecting a good domain name. If you are making a website for yourself, maybe try to use your first and last name? Think "johnsmith.com". Even if you aren’t promoting yourself, it’s not a bad idea to get your name as a domain now, in case you want to use it in the future. If you are marketing your business, you will want to use your company name. Think “yourbusiness.com.” And if already taken, do not forget the other Domain Extensions: "johnsmith.pro" - "johnsmith.biz" - “yourbusiness.info”.

domain hosting

Design Your Layout

Designing your website layout involves planning the structure to ensure a seamless user experience. Start with a clear and intuitive homepage that highlights your key messages and guides visitors to important sections. Use a consistent navigation menu to help users easily find information. Design content pages with a logical flow, incorporating headings, subheadings, and clear calls to action. Prioritize a responsive design that adapts to different screen sizes, ensuring your site looks great on both desktops and mobile devices.
Plan the structure of your website:

  • • Homepage: The main landing page that introduces your site
  • • Navigation: Menus and links to other pages
  • • Content Pages: About, Services, Contact, Blog, etc
  • • Footer: Additional information like contact details, social media links, and copyright.

Create Your Content

Content is all the information contained on your Website. This can be text, links, images, audio, animation videos or anything you can post to a web page. It is important to create and maintain clear, useful, unique content so visitors can quickly and easily understand your message. Poorly written text will frustrate and discourage visitors from staying on your website or coming back. Search Engines will reward you by ranking your pages higher if you make an effort to create quality content. Making sure you have fresh content appearing on your website on a regular basis will also help with ranking.

Add Visuals

Adding visuals to your website is crucial for engaging visitors and enhancing user experience. Incorporate high-quality images, videos, and graphics that align with your brand and content. Ensure visuals are optimized for fast loading times to avoid slowing down your site. Use relevant images to complement and illustrate your text, and consider including infographics to convey complex information clearly. Consistent and visually appealing elements can make your site more attractive and memorable.
Creating a promotional video for your new website is an effective strategy to boost visibility and engagement. A well-crafted promo video can succinctly showcase your brand's message, highlight key features, and drive traffic to your site. Utilizing dynamic visuals and compelling storytelling, your video can capture the attention of potential customers and encourage them to explore your offerings.
Balance visuals with text to maintain readability and ensure a professional look. Thoughtfully chosen visuals can significantly impact how users interact with and perceive your website.

Implement Calls to Action

Implementing calls to action (CTAs) is vital for guiding users toward desired actions on your website. Place clear, compelling CTAs throughout your site. Use contrasting colors and strategic positioning to make CTAs stand out. Ensure the language is action-oriented and aligns with the content to drive engagement. Effective CTAs can enhance user experience, increase conversions, and help achieve your site’s goals by prompting visitors to interact with your site in meaningful ways.
Examples include:

  • • Sign Up: For newsletters or special offers
  • • Contact Us: For inquiries or support
  • • Buy Now: For e-commerce sites

Search Engine Optimization (SEO)

Search Engine Optimization (SEO) is essential for improving your website's visibility on search engines. Start by researching and incorporating relevant keywords into your content, titles, and meta descriptions. Optimize your site’s structure with clear headings, internal links, and a user-friendly URL format. Ensure fast loading times and mobile responsiveness to enhance user experience. Use alt text for images and create high-quality, engaging content to attract visitors and boost rankings. Regularly update your site and monitor performance with tools like Google Analytics to refine your SEO strategy and maintain strong search engine visibility.

Website Hosting

Mobile Responsiveness

Mobile responsiveness ensures your website performs well on all devices, including smartphones and tablets. Design your site to adapt seamlessly to various screen sizes by using flexible layouts, images, and media queries. Prioritize a user-friendly interface with touch-friendly navigation and easy-to-read text on smaller screens. Test your site across different devices and browsers to ensure consistent performance and usability. A mobile-responsive design improves user experience, boosts engagement, and is favored by search engines, enhancing your site’s visibility and accessibility. Ensuring responsiveness is crucial for meeting the needs of today’s mobile-first users.

Page Speed

Optimize your website’s speed for better user experience and search engine ranking. Page speed is crucial for user experience and SEO. Ensure your website loads quickly by optimizing images, minifying CSS and JavaScript, and leveraging browser caching.
Techniques include:

  • • Compressing Images: Reduce file sizes without sacrificing quality
  • • Minifying Code: Remove unnecessary code from HTML, CSS, and JavaScript
  • • Caching: Use caching to store frequently accessed data and reduce load times

Test Your Website

Testing your website before launching is crucial for ensuring a smooth user experience. Thoroughly check all links, forms, and interactive elements to confirm they work correctly. Test your site across different browsers and devices to ensure compatibility and responsiveness. Assess page speed, loading times, and overall performance to identify and fix any issues. Review content for accuracy and consistency, and ensure SEO elements like meta tags are properly implemented. By addressing potential problems before launch, you ensure a functional, user-friendly website that delivers a positive experience and achieves your goals effectively.

Backup Your Site

Backing up your website is essential for data protection and recovery. Regularly create backups of your site’s files and databases to safeguard against data loss due to technical issues or security breaches. Use automated backup solutions offered by your hosting provider or third-party tools to schedule regular backups. Store backups in secure locations, such as cloud storage or external drives, and ensure they are easily accessible. Testing backup restoration periodically ensures that your backups are functional and reliable. Regular backups provide peace of mind and a quick recovery option in case of unexpected problems.

Blog Hosting

Listing Different Types of Websites

Websites come in all different shapes and sizes. And many different types or combination of types. Which you choose will depend on what you want to achieve with your website and the functionality you will need with it.

Weblogs, Blogs or Online Diaries

A blog can be an extra feature for any website, or it can be a separate kind of site on its own. These websites are most likely written by individuals solely for the purpose of writing on their interested topics. Blogs are usually arranged in chronological order, with the most recent entry at the top of the main page and older entries toward the bottom.
Recommended reading: The Best Blog Platforms for Beginners, Businesses and Content Creators.

Business Card Website

For some businesses, a simple one-page website with the company name, description, contact info and maybe a logo may be all that’s needed. You can also include products or other information, but the basic concept is a simple one-page website that represents your company or yourself.

Portfolio Website

A portfolio website is similar to a business card website, except you will have a section where you showcase your work or interests and options for contacting you. Photography studios commonly use this type of website, so do design firms and other creative endeavors.

Social Networking Website

Social interactions, online meetings, chatting, social updates exist on social networking websites sometimes called social media. Some of the most popular social Websites are:

SSH

Product Brochure Website

This website is an extension of your business or company’s sales and marketing efforts. You will be able to show goods and services you offer to browse through. Brochure type website may include some pricing guidelines, but normally will not allow purchases here.

Company or Organization Website

Any company or any organization can have its own and unique online presence with a company website. It offers various products and services that are showcased on the website. For example a company creating goods, with the use of the website can put down the various locations of the shops, stores and or dealers and for the different products on the website.

E-commerce Website

E-commerce websites are online markets for any product you want to buy online. You can choose a variety of products of any kind from different ranges.
Some examples of E-commerce websites are:
Amazon   Ebay   Walmart   Target  and many more.
With an E-commerce website, you will be able to showcase your business and your products or services, allowing purchases online. The setup process for an eCommerce site may at first seem overwhelming, but there are many simplified methods and tools that will help you to sell online.

Search Engines

Google, need we say more. Delivering searches related to any query entered by a user on a search engine website. Using special algorithms and technology. It gives most of the time appropriately related links for the user to find the content they are looking for.

Other popular search engines are
Bing
Yahoo
AOL.com
DuckDuckGo
Yandex
U Search
Giphy
Longer list here

Online Privacy

Forums

Online Forums or community websites are used by its users to participate in and converse about particular topics or discussion to find answers to specific questions. It is a kind of interaction as in a social networking website.

File Sharing or Downloading Websites

Search for media, music, software, pdf. files. Almost anything, and share it or download it from a file sharing website. You can additionally upload files to them, if allowed, for further use or for others to download.

Web Hosting Provider

Selecting a reliable hosting provider can be one of the most important decisions you make. To a large degree, the functionality and performance of your website will depend on your hosting provider. The Host makes sure your site is available to potential readers 24/7 and this is where your website files are stored online. The wrong Host can cause many problems with your website. Your web host is a major piece of the puzzle to maintaining a successful internet Website. It is crucial that you choose a reliable provider.
And of course, we recommend RSH Web Services to host your website.

The design of your website is critical, and people will form an opinion about you and or your business based on the look and feel. Most visitors will make an instant decision whether to stay or go. So to make that all important impact, it’s crucial to have great design.

Summary

Creating a website may seem like a daunting task for beginners, but with the right guidance and tools, it’s entirely achievable. By following this comprehensive guide, you can successfully plan, design, and launch your website, ensuring it meets your goals and provides value to your visitors. Remember, the key to a successful website is continuous improvement and adaptation. Keep learning, stay updated with industry trends, and regularly refine your site to achieve long-term success.

Author Bio:

A guest blogger hailing from Switzerland, dedicated to assisting local companies in expanding their reach from regional to national and international levels. With a proven track record in...

If you would like some help getting your website online and establishing your presence on the Internet, RSH Web Services is here to help design and build a great website for you.

We welcome your comments, questions, corrections and additional information relating to this article. Please be aware that off-topic comments will be deleted.
If you need specific help with your account, feel free to contact us anytime
Thank you

COMMENTS


Tweet  Share  Pin  Email.


Brought to you by our skilled copywriting minds

For your business, home or just personal use. Since 1997 RSH Web Services has offered the best hosting services